Description

This plugin will add new settings to your Settings -> Permalinks screen for you to
specify your blog’s shortlink structure. By default WordPress shortlinks look like
http://yrnxt.com/?p=153. Using this plugin you can specify every other structure
you like, e.g. http://yrnxt.com/~153.

Specifying new shortlink structures will never break WordPress’ default. Also when
changing the shortlink structure again afterwards old structures won’t break until you
explicitly remove them.

Installation

  1. Visit your WordPress Administration interface and go to Plugins -> Add New
  2. Search for “Custom Shortlink Structure“, and click “Install Now” below the plugin’s name
  3. When the installation finished, click “Activate Plugin

Now visit Settings -> Permalinks and specify your own shortlink structure. Changes here won’t
break WordPress default ?p=%post_id% structure.

Frequently Asked Questions

When visiting a shortlink defined using the plugin I just get redirected to home?

Some other plugins might interfere with redirections. Using WordPress SEO’s Redirect ugly URL’s to clean permalinks setting for example will break this plugin.

I specified a custom shortlink structure but get a “Not Found” error on load

The plugin only works when pretty permalinks are enabled. Under Settings -> Permalinks
specify a permalink structure other then default.
